YS-N350 Wave Soldering Machine Overview
Industrial-grade high-quality wave soldering system designed for precision SMT PCB electronic component soldering with advanced automation and environmental features.
Key Features & Benefits
  • Efficient, energy-saving design with lead-free, environmentally friendly operation
  • Automatic power system with frequency converter control and automatic board input
  • Precision flux spray system using scanning nozzles, Japanese components, and PLC control
  • Three-zone independent temperature control preheating system with ±2ºC uniformity
  • Special alloy transportation chain claws with non-stick tin properties
  • Import high-frequency conversion motor for stable tin stove performance
  • Lead-free solder furnace with independent environmental safety design
  • High-speed PID control with dual independent infrared heating
  • Programmable timing functions with 90-minute heating capability
  • Black box memory function for production management records
  • Automatic claw cleaning system for consistent operation
  • Comprehensive fault security alarm system for operator safety
